Transaction 898b8313d0fa70760f808e2a1c600a2027164ed3bf32aab8fde37060a0128653
1 Input
1 Output
-
898b8313d0fa70760f808e2a1c600a2027164ed3bf32aab8fde37060a0128653:0
- value
- 14980000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d0d4e1f0c3d522d8beb5219171623de18732b14 OP_EQUAL
- address
- 34LdTZm66o5RVo2ZnPWyDqocYZdA4VLxmy